Description
No gift is as precious as the love of a friend. A great project to use up scrap yarn, this bag would knit up well in just about any fiber. The subtle detailing in the colored bands is achieved with slipped stitches and occasional purls, but plain Stockinette Stitch stripes would do just as well. This bag is so lovely, you could almost get away with giving it empty, just as its own sweet self!

What materials are needed for The Gift Is the Bag?
To make The Gift Is the Bag you will need: Premier Home Cotton Yarn (105yds/96m; 2.1oz/60g; 85% cotton/15% polyester) yarn: 1 Ball Each White (MC), Ocean Splash (CC1), Flamingo Splash (CC2), Tangerine Splash (CC3), & Honeydew Splash (CC4), 2 - 2.5@q (2.5 foot) lengths of ribbon. Tools required: Size 8 Knitting Needles.
